Method

Preparation

1

Preheat the Oven

Preheat your oven to 350°F (175°C) to ensure it’s hot enough for baking.

2

Mix Dry Ingredients

In a large bowl, whisk together the all-purpose flour, granulated sugar, baking powder, and salt until well combined.

3

Combine Wet Ingredients

In another bowl, beat together the milk, eggs, and melted unsalted butter until smooth. If using, add vanilla extract at this stage.

4

Combine Mixtures

Gradually add the wet ingredients to the dry ingredients, stirring gently until just combined. Do not overmix.

5

Add Flavor Additions

Fold in any of the flavor additions you choose to use, such as cocoa powder, chopped nuts, fresh berries, or chocolate chips.

Baking

6

Prepare Baking Pan

Grease and flour a baking pan of your choice (9x13 inch is recommended) to prevent sticking.

7

Pour Batter

Pour the batter into the prepared baking pan, spreading it evenly with a spatula.

8

Bake

Place the baking pan in the preheated oven and bake for 30-35 minutes or until a toothpick inserted into the center comes out clean.

9

Cool

Once baked, remove from the oven and allow to cool in the pan for 10 minutes before transferring to a wire rack to cool completely.
